This paper addresses the static bicycle rebalancing problem with multiple vehicles and multiple visits. The objective is to rebalance the stations of a bicycle-sharing system to reach the target number of good bicycles minimizing the total travelling time using a fleet of homogeneous vehicles. The vehicles have identical capacities and service time limits, and are allowed to visit the stations multiple times. One major challenge is that the unusable bicycles and the maintenance operations of bicycles are considered. In this paper, we propose a mixed integer programming model for solving the problem. The repair station is introduced to the model and all unusable bicycles at stations are delivered to the repair station. Considering the possibility of being outsourced to a third-party service company, our study requires that all vehicles depart from and return to the depot with no bicycles.The mathematical formulation of the problem is computationally tested.
